Hello, I'm Alicia, but you can call me Alice
Born on the outskirts of Barcelona, Spain, I grew up twenty minutes from the iconic Sagrada Familia, immersed in stories, myths, and the eerie landscapes of imagination.
I hold a degree in English Philology from the Universitat de Barcelona (2008) and a Master’s in Jungian Psychology from Universidad de Nebrija (2024). I have also completed specialist training in Jungian studies through the Centre for Applied Jungian Studies and I am currently completing further studies in grief and depth psychology.
I am an essayist and independent researcher exploring the relationship between culture, symbolism, and the human psyche. My work investigates how human beings give symbolic form to the deepest questions of existence: loss, identity, transformation, belonging, fear, and the search for meaning.
Gothic literature is one of my main fields of exploration, not only as a literary genre, but as a symbolic language that reveals the hidden tensions of individuals and societies. Through Gothic narratives, mythology, art, and depth psychology, I explore the ways in which stories become mirrors of our inner and collective worlds.
For over twenty years, I worked as an English teacher, running my own academy for ten years. This background continues to influence my research, especially my interest in how stories shape learning, identity, and our understanding of ourselves and others.
My academic contributions include essays for forthcoming collections:
- Women in Supernatural,Critical Essays – The Misunderstood Role of Mary Winchester as a Fragmented Self. McFarland
- Horror and Mother/hoods in Global Cultural Imaginaries: Representations Across Literature, Film, Television, and Art – The Monstrous Mother: A Personal Journey through Motherhood, Loss, and the Psychological Haunting under the Gothic-Jungian Lens. Demeter Press - Horror and Rewilding – Descent to the Great Mother Achetype: an Exploration of the Human Psyche in the TV series "Dark". Edited by Simon Bacon
I’ve co-authored Diario para madres escritoras II: Un nuevo comienzo and contributed to seminars exploring the Great Mother archetype, Gothic symbolism, the ghostly, and the second language learning through the Gothic .
I am currently writing my first solo Gothic novel and developing The Gothic Descent, an independent research and editorial project exploring how cultural expressions respond to the existential questions of their time.
